Lagos State Police Command has dismissed rumors circulating online about an alleged explosion in the state.
EpeInsights reports that the Commissioner of Police, Olohundare Jimoh, clarified the situation in a statement released on Saturday, explaining that no explosion occurred on Friday, April 19, 2025.
Jimoh explained that the viral video causing panic actually stemmed from an explosion that occurred on April 11 at a CCTV shop in Computer Village, Ikeja.
The investigation into that incident is still ongoing.
The Commissioner reassured residents that there was no cause for concern, urging them to continue their daily activities without fear.
He emphasized that proactive measures have been put in place to ensure police presence and a safe environment for all.
Jimoh also urged social media users and bloggers to refrain from spreading misinformation that could provoke unnecessary panic or anxiety among the public.
He reaffirmed the police’s commitment to safeguarding lives and maintaining peace throughout Lagos.
